理解计算机中的运算符:基本概念与使用方法

作者:问题终结者2024.01.17 05:33浏览量:35

简介:计算机中的运算符用于执行各种数学和逻辑运算。本文将介绍运算符的基本概念、分类以及使用方法,帮助读者更好地理解和应用这些概念。

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

在计算机科学中,运算符是一种特殊符号,用于指示计算机执行特定的数学或逻辑运算。运算符可以用于处理数值、字符串、布尔值等数据类型,是编程中不可或缺的元素。
一、运算符的分类
根据操作数的数量和运算类型,运算符可以分为一元运算符、二元运算符和三元运算符。

  1. 一元运算符:只对一个操作数进行运算,包括正号(+)、负号(-)、逻辑非(NOT)等。
  2. 二元运算符:对两个操作数进行运算,如加法(+)、减法(-)、乘法(*)、除法(/)等。
  3. 三元运算符:对三个操作数进行运算,也称为条件运算符,形式为“条件 ? 结果1 : 结果2”。
    二、运算符的使用方法
  4. 算术运算符:用于执行基本的数学运算,如加、减、乘、除等。使用算术运算符时需要注意数据类型和精度问题。
  5. 赋值运算符:用于将右边的值赋给左边的变量,形式为“变量=值”。常见的赋值运算符有“=”、“+=”、“-=”、“*=”、“/=”等。
  6. 比较运算符:用于比较两个值的大小关系,返回布尔值(True或False)。比较运算符包括“==”(等于)、“!=”(不等于)、“>”(大于)、“<”(小于)、“>=”(大于等于)、“<=”(小于等于)等。
  7. 逻辑运算符:用于处理布尔逻辑关系,包括与(AND)、或(OR)、非(NOT)等。逻辑运算符在编程中经常用于控制流程,如条件判断、循环控制等。
  8. 位运算符:用于对二进制位进行操作,包括位与(&)、位或(|)、位非(~)、位异或(^)、左移(<<)、右移(>>)等。位运算符常用于底层编程和算法优化。
  9. 字符串运算符:用于拼接和操作字符串,使用“+”号连接字符串。还可以使用一些内置函数来处理字符串,如len()获取长度、upper()转换为大写、lower()转换为小写等。
  10. 成员运算符:用于检查一个对象是否包含某个属性或方法,使用“in”关键字。例如,“if ‘method’ in object”。
  11. 身份运算符:用于比较两个对象是否为同一个对象,使用“is”关键字。例如,“if object1 is object2”。
  12. 异常运算符:用于抛出异常和处理异常,使用“try/except”语句块。通过抛出异常来通知程序出现错误,并通过异常处理机制来捕获和处理异常。
    通过掌握这些运算符的分类和使用方法,我们可以在编程中更加灵活地处理各种数据类型和逻辑关系。在实际应用中,需要根据具体的需求选择合适的运算符,并注意数据类型和精度问题,以避免出现意外的结果或错误。同时,不断实践和积累经验也是提高编程能力的关键。
article bottom image

相关文章推荐

发表评论